How Reliable is the Volkswagen Touran?

Based on 1,718,428 MOT tests across 119,227 vehicles.

74.9%
Pass Rate
8,178
Miles/Year
23
Year Lifespan
119,227
On UK Roads

Top MOT Failure Points

T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m 45,204
Tyre has ply or cords exposed 23,205
coil spring broken 18,609
constant velocity joint gaiter damaged to the extent that it no longer prevents the ingress of dirt etc 14,479
Brake pad(s) less than 1.5 mm thick 13,811
